I had the same flickering white lines om mega (5V).
Put the same display om "Freaduino" (can switch between 3.3V and 5V)
Result:
Perfectly OK when running on 3.3V
White, flickering lines when running on 5V
Maybe as simple as a resistor in series with each dataline can to the trick of reducing input voltage
